6 AI agents for governed document sharing. Auto PII masking across 40+ jurisdictions, Bedrock Guardrails pre/post validation, HITL/HITR review gates, HMAC audit. From 4999 USD/yr.
Central DataStore deploys 6 specialist AI agents governing your document sharing pipeline. Upload documents. Agents auto-detect compliance domain, scan and mask PII via Bedrock Guardrails, route through HITL/HITR human review, and deliver masked versions with immutable compliance proof.
6 AI AGENTS:
Domain Classification: Auto-detects healthcare/finance/legal/education. Routes to correct framework.
SECURITY: AES-256 KMS at rest. TLS 1.3 transit. Per-tenant isolation (S3+DynamoDB+KMS). API key + Bearer auth. HMAC-SHA256 audit, 7yr retention, tamper-proof. Data deletion 72hrs. Incident notification 24hrs. No AI training on customer data.

Pricing works through Document Processing Units, where the number of units you buy sets your service tier. One unit gives you the Starter tier, covering 5,000 documents per month and 10 clients. Three units move you to Professional, raising limits to 50,000 documents and 100 clients while adding Human-in-the-Loop review and DataZone. Ten units unlock Enterprise, with unlimited documents, Clean Rooms, and Bring Your Own Key encryption. So the units act as fixed tier steps rather than a smooth per-document scale. You choose a tier by selecting its unit count.
Top-of-mind questions for buyers
What counts as one document for the monthly document limits in each tier?
A document is a single file you upload for processing through the pipeline. Each upload runs through domain detection, PII scanning, masking, and validation. The Starter unit covers 5,000 documents per month, Professional covers 50,000, and Enterprise removes the monthly cap entirely.
What happens if my document volume grows beyond the Starter tier limits?
Volume growth does not auto-scale within a tier. You move up by buying more Document Processing Units — 3 units for Professional or 10 units for Enterprise. Each step raises document, client, and integration limits. Enterprise removes document and storage caps. The transition is a manual tier change, not automatic overflow billing.
Which capabilities require moving to a higher unit count rather than staying on Starter?
Starter includes standard PII masking, 13-jurisdiction resolution, validation gates, and an audit trail. Professional (3 units) adds Human-in-the-Loop review and DataZone integration. Enterprise (10 units) adds Clean Rooms PII analysis and Bring Your Own Key encryption. These features are tied to the unit count you select.

All plans include documentation and email support at support@aaiss.ai. Professional includes priority 4-hour SLA. Enterprise includes dedicated CSM 1-hour 24x7. Security incidents notified within 24 hours. Vulnerability reporting: security@aaiss.ai. Data deletion within 72 hours on request.
